The Model Context Protocol Is About to Change Everything

The Model Context Protocol is an open standard that enables AI systems to share context and capabilities across different applications without custom integration work. This matters for ecommerce sellers because it removes the technical barriers that have traditionally prevented small businesses from using multiple AI tools together effectively.

For years, ecommerce operations have struggled with disconnected AI tools that require expensive development work to communicate with each other. The Model Context Protocol changes this equation entirely by creating a universal language that AI applications can speak fluently.

Understanding How the Protocol Works

The Model Context Protocol operates as a bridge between AI models and the tools they need to access. When an AI system follows MCP standards, it can discover available capabilities in other applications and use them without requiring API keys, custom code, or developer assistance. This means a product photography tool can communicate directly with a mockup generator, allowing automated workflows that previously required technical expertise to set up.

Businesses implementing MCP report integration development times drop by approximately 80%, replacing weeks of custom coding with hours of configuration work.

Consider a typical product listing workflow. Traditionally, a seller would need to manually photograph products, upload images to a background removal tool, save the results, then import them into a mockup generator. Each step requires human intervention and file transfers. With the Model Context Protocol, these tools can pass context directly between each other, creating automated pipelines that complete the entire workflow without manual handoffs.

How does MCP improve product photography consistency?

The Model Context Protocol enables tools to share processing parameters and quality standards automatically. When a photography studio tool captures product images, it can communicate the lighting conditions, camera settings, and capture parameters to downstream tools. This ensures that background removal, color correction, and mockup generation all apply consistent treatments based on the original capture data rather than making independent assumptions.

What security considerations should sellers address with MCP workflows?

MCP workflows require careful attention to data handling practices. Ensure that all connected tools follow your data retention policies and that context sharing only includes information necessary for each specific workflow step. Review the security certifications of tools before connecting them, and maintain audit logs of data flows for compliance purposes.
